Latest Patents
Hwang holds a patent for an "OTP-based authentication system and method." This invention presents a robust authentication system that incorporates a transceiver designed to receive an authentication request containing a client-side One-Time Password (OTP) and encoded account information. The system enables the decoding of the account information to compute the necessary data for authentication and generates a corresponding server-side OTP for verification. The method involves comparing both the client-side and server-side OTPs to authenticate the user effectively, providing an intelligent solution for secure online transactions.
